About the role

Being a Credit Analyst on the Equipment Financing team at National Bank means serving as a key expert in credit evaluation. This job allows you to make meaningful impact on our organization through your expertise in financial analysis, risk management, and loan structuring. You'll play a key role in supporting Canadian businesses by offering tailored financing solutions that help them grow and thrive.

This is an important role in delivering effective risk-based loan pricing and profitability management. These credit gurus act as subject matter experts providing guidance and support to credit associates and support teams, enhancing the development of our credit capabilities.

Your role:

Client engagement. Credit underwriting. Risk management. Learning.

  • Analyze credit application and recommend appropriate financing structures
  • Collaborate with Relationship Managers and Risk Management teams to support sound credit decisions
  • Approve credit requests within delegated limits and prepare recommendations for complex cases
  • Ensure compliance with internal policies and regulatory requirements
  • Contribute to portfolio assessments to identify risks and propose mitigation strategies

Prerequisites:

  • A diploma or bachelor's degree in Finance, Commerce, or a related field is required
  • Minimum 1-3 years of experience in financial services, risk management, or commercial lending
  • Strong skills in financial statement analysis and credit evaluation
  • Knowledge of collateral requirements and credit documentation
